In the most basic way of defining, a leader is a person who leads other.
But what makes someone a leader? Leadership itself can be described
differently. One of the most famous definition of leadership is “a process of social
influence in which one person can enlist the aid and support of others”.
That is, to become a leader, is not always about managing and organizing a team,
but we must learn to help, support, and develop other.
Teenagers are the future leaders, they are the generation who needs to know about
leadership, how to implement it into their life, and how to givean impact to the society.
However, teenagers are not aware of their potential to become leaders, or do not know
about the leadership and lack of knowledge about leadership.
One of the knowledge that young leaders need to know is also that the obstacle to
become leaders nowadays is cross-cultural leadership, leading people from different
backgrounds and cultures. Future leaders must learn how to become leaders in a global
world.
Realizing the need to improve youth leadership, especially in Indonesia,
we want to start to develop leadership skills and knowledge of youth around us.
As the biggest global youth organization which is AIESEC, we are planning to run a
PboX (Project Based on Exchange) entitled LEAD, that will hopefully fulfill the youth
need of leadership knowledge and skills.

EVENT DESCRIPTION
1. Webinar (Web Seminar) Webinar is the tool for Exchange Participants and the Exchanger from
AIESEC President University to meet on media social using video call conference
with the purposes for informing the Exchange Participants anything related to their
arrival, activities during the “realization”, schedule, etc.
2. Incoming Seminar Seminar will be conducted by Exchange Participants, Committee of LEAD Project,
and AIESEC-ers from President University. The purposes of Incoming Seminar are
to welcoming the Exchange Participants, introducing, and informing them
about their project
3. Project Trip Project trip is the trip as welcoming the Exchange Participants before their project
is started. It has purposes to introduce them about Indonesian culture and about
the city that we will visit and to have bonding with the exchange participant.
The project trip will be held in Saung Angklung Mang Udjo, Bandung.
4. Road Show to Public Junior High School Road show means that we will visit 3 (three) Public Junior High
Schools in Jababeka, CIkarang. These 3 (three) schools are for
3 (three) weeks. It is the main project for the Exchange Participants
to coach them about “Leadership” as our project concern.
